“MySQL安装难题解析:为何你的数据库总装不上?”

为什么我的mysql装不上去

时间:2025-07-31 19:36


为什么我的MySQL装不上去?——深入解析安装难题 在数字化时代,数据库作为信息存储与管理的核心,对于个人用户和企业而言都至关重要

    MySQL,作为一款开源的关系型数据库管理系统,因其性能稳定、功能强大且易于操作而受到广泛欢迎

    然而,在安装MySQL的过程中,不少用户会遇到各种各样的问题,导致安装失败

    本文将从多个角度深入剖析“为什么我的MySQL装不上去”这一问题,并提供相应的解决方案

     一、系统兼容性问题 MySQL的安装首先需要考虑的是与操作系统的兼容性

    不同版本的MySQL对操作系统有其特定的要求

    例如,较新版本的MySQL可能不支持某些老旧的操作系统

    因此,在安装之前,用户需要确认自己的操作系统版本是否支持所选的MySQL版本

     解决方案: 1. 查看MySQL官方文档,了解支持的操作系统版本

     2.升级操作系统或选择与当前系统兼容的MySQL版本

     二、安装包损坏或不完整 下载过程中网络波动、存储设备故障等原因都可能导致MySQL安装包损坏或不完整

    使用这样的安装包进行安装,自然会遇到各种问题

     解决方案: 1. 重新从官方网站或可信的软件仓库下载MySQL安装包

     2. 对比校验和(如MD5、SHA256等)以确保下载的安装包完整无误

     三、权限不足 在安装软件时,尤其是像MySQL这样的系统级应用,需要足够的权限才能写入系统目录、修改配置文件等

    如果用户以普通权限运行安装程序,很可能会因为权限不足而导致安装失败

     解决方案: 1. 使用管理员权限(在Windows系统中为“以管理员身份运行”,在Linux系统中使用sudo命令)运行安装程序

     2. 确保当前用户有足够的权限来安装和配置MySQL

     四、端口冲突 MySQL默认使用3306端口

    如果该端口已被其他程序占用,MySQL将无法成功安装或启动

     解决方案: 1. 使用网络工具(如netstat、lsof等)检查3306端口是否被占用

     2. 如果被占用,可以尝试停止占用端口的程序,或者修改MySQL的配置文件,使用其他端口

     五、依赖问题 MySQL的安装和运行依赖于一系列的系统库和组件

    如果这些依赖项缺失或版本不匹配,安装过程可能会受阻

     解决方案: 1. 根据MySQL的官方文档,确认并安装所有必需的依赖项

     2. 使用包管理器(如apt、yum等)来自动处理依赖关系

     六、配置文件错误 在安装过程中,用户可能需要根据自己的环境手动编辑配置文件

    如果配置文件中的参数设置错误,或者格式不符合规范,都可能导致安装失败

     解决方案: 1.仔细阅读MySQL的配置文件文档,了解每个参数的含义和正确设置方法

     2. 使用文本编辑器打开配置文件,检查并修正错误

     3. 在修改配置文件后,重新启动MySQL服务以应用更改

     七、磁盘空间不足 如果安装MySQL的目标磁盘空间不足,安装程序将无法正常进行

    这通常发生在用户尝试将MySQL安装到容量较小的分区或磁盘上

     解决方案: 1. 检查目标磁盘的剩余空间,确保足够安装MySQL及其相关数据

     2. 如果空间不足,可以清理不必要的文件,或者选择其他有足够空间的磁盘进行安装

     八、防火墙或安全软件拦截 有时,防火墙或安全软件可能会误判MySQL的安装或运行行为为潜在威胁,从而进行拦截

    这可能导致安装过程中的网络连接失败或其他异常

     解决方案: 1. 检查防火墙和安全软件的设置,确保MySQL的相关进程和端口被允许通过

     2. 如果需要,可以暂时禁用防火墙或安全软件,以排除其干扰

    但请注意,在安装完成后及时重新启用以保护系统安全

     结语 MySQL的安装问题可能由多种原因导致,但通过仔细分析和逐一排查,这些问题都是可以解决的

    本文提供了一些常见的安装难题及其解决方案,希望能帮助到遇到困难的用户

    在安装过程中保持耐心和细心,是确保成功安装MySQL的关键